1. SYSTEM DATA : To decide Base kV and Base kVA (/MVA) for the entire system.
2. BUS DATA :
Bus number
Bus name
Bus type : - Load Bus
- Generator Bus
- Swing Bus
- Disconnected Bus
Load :
- in MW and MVAR at nominal voltage
- Voltage dependent
- Frequency dependent
- Load schedule
Shunt : in MVAR at nominal voltage with proper sign convention to distinguish
between reactor & capacitor
Per unit voltage & angle
Bus base kV
3. GENERATOR DATA :
Real power output in MW
Max. reactive power output in MVAR
Min. reactive power output in MVAR
Scheduled voltage in pu.
Generation schedule
Generator in service/ out of service state
Generator operating chart
Generator MVA base
Generators steady state internal impedance
4. BRANCH/INTERCONNECTOR DATA :
For transmission line :
Resistance
Reactance : Details of line configuration, phase spacing, type of conductor etc.
Charging susceptance (shunt capacitance)
Line rating : current rating in A or in MVA

For non transmission line : Specify whether it is a series reactor, series capacitor or
transformer devoid of susceptance term
5. TRANSFORMER DATA :
Name plate rating data : MVA, Voltage ratio, % impedance on own base
Tap setting in pu.
Tap angle in degree
For load tap changing transformer :
- Max. tap position
- Min. tap position
- Scheduled voltage range with tap step size
